Endotoxins are little bacterially-derived hydrophobic lipopolysaccharide (LPS) molecules that can easily contaminate labware and whose existence can significantly influence the two in vitro and in vivo experiments. Their existence is detected through the limulus amebocyte lysate (LAL assay) that may detect down to 0.01 endotoxin units (EU)/mL. Endotoxins are approximately 10 kDa in dimension, but conveniently form massive aggregates approximately one,000 kDa. Bacteria drop endotoxin in significant quantities upon cell death and when they're actively expanding and dividing.

A pyrogen can be a substance that causes fever immediately after intravenous administration or inhalation. Gram adverse endotoxins are A very powerful pyrogens to pharmaceutical laboratories. From the International, United states of america, Japanese and European Pharmacopoeias, There are 2 Formal methods To judge pyrogenicity—that is definitely, the bacterial endotoxin test, along with the pyrogen test.
